Frequently Asked Questions
What is the ICD-10 code for effusion, other site?

The ICD-10-CM code for effusion, other site is M25.48. The full clinical description is "Effusion, other site". M25.48 is a billable/specific code that can be used on insurance claims and medical billing.

What does ICD-10 code M25.48 mean?

ICD-10-CM code M25.48 represents “Effusion, other site”. It is classified under Chapter 13: Diseases of the Musculoskeletal System and Connective Tissue and is a billable/specific code that can be used on a claim.

Is M25.48 a billable code?

Yes, M25.48 is a billable/specific ICD-10-CM code and can be used to indicate a diagnosis on a medical claim.

What chapter is M25.48 in?

M25.48 is in Chapter 13: Diseases of the Musculoskeletal System and Connective Tissue (codes M00-M99).

What codes cannot be used with M25.48?

M25.48 has Excludes1 notes indicating codes that cannot be used together with it, including: hydrarthrosis in yaws (A66.6); intermittent hydrarthrosis (M12.4-); other infective (teno)synovitis (M65.1-).
